SPECIAL TAKEAWAY BY TPC KUALA LUMPUR!

April 29, 2020 by StrawberrY Gal

As we embrace the new normal during these challenging times, Malaysia’s Family- Friendly club, TPC Kuala Lumpur presents a Sundown takeaway menu this Ramadan available from 1 until 22 May 2020 specially prepared by Golfer’s Terrace. You can now take some time off from the kitchen and enjoy a delightful dish at the comfort of your home.

Orders are open from 1.00 pm to 6.30 pm and must be made 1 hour in advance by calling our team at 03-2011 9189.  Only cashless payment in the form of Debit or Credit Card is applicable and a drive-through concept for pick-up only are available at the West Lobby Porte-cochere between 3.30pm and 6.30pm.

Local favourites include Nasi Lemak with Chicken Rendang, Nasi Tomato set, Biryani Chicken, Chicken and Beef Masak Lemak, Seafood Noodle Soup, Roti John Chicken, Cream Caramel and more are priced from RM 14+ onwards.

For bigger groups, two different Hidang Set Menus are also available perfect for 4 persons priced at RM 78+ per set. Set A menu feature dishes like Ayam Masak Lemak Cili Api, Daging Masak Lada Hitam, Sayur Taugeh and Tauhu Sos Tiram, Telur Dadar Cili and Bawang. Meanwhile Set B include dishes like Ayam Tumis Berlada, Tenggiri Masak Lemak Cili Api, Fried Choy Sam Vegetables and Fried Egg Foo Young. Both sets come with fluffy steamed white rice, Ulam and Sambal Belacan.

In accordance to the advice by the authorities, TPCKL’s Buffet of the Year has been called off. Members and guests may choose to utilise the purchased vouchers at Golfer’s Terrace until 31 December 2020 or obtain a refund by submitting the original vouchers at the Golf payment counter when the club reopens.
